First and foremost, file a report with local agencies that deal in searching lost pets or get in touch with animal shelters and animal control authorities such as the Humane Association. If there is no animal shelter, then you contact the nearest police department to find your lost pet. Providing these agencies with the exact description or a photo of your pet will help them find it fast. Do post the information of your lost pet on websites that are designed to help people track their pets.

Do show a recent photograph of your pet to neighborhoods, delivery servicemen or local shop owners and ask them about your pet as they may have seen your pet. Searching at the local garden or a nearby park may also help since most of the times it is seen that loved pets take shelter in open spacious park after straying away from home.

Do post a notice that includes vital information about the pet such as age, weight, breed, color and any special markings at important places in Nashville city. Asking people at grocery stores, community centers, traffic intersections, pet supply stores and veterinary offices can also help sometimes. Placing advertisements in local newspapers can also prove to be effective in finding your lost pet.
